I’m thinking of getting some touring leathers, which I can also use on a commute. There are a few products which have come into the market in the last few years or so that are ‘waterproof’ touring leathers, and wondered if anyone had any experience of them?
HELD
HELD are known to me for making good motorcycle gloves and I have heard good things about their leathers
The Quattrotempi Rezzato Gore-Tex leather jacket comes in at £800 and the Quattrotempi 5060 Gore-Tex leather trousers at £650
Hein Gerick
Are similarly priced to the HELD at £800 for the jacket and £700 for the trousers, Hein Gerick offer the Tour Cool Gore-Tex suit. Sometimes build quality can be a little suspect on Hein Gerick stuff, and the all important part of any waterproof material like Gore-Tex are the seams, so these need to be checked for where they are placed and how well they are taped. But Hein Gerick do have good customer service in their favour, so far as returns are concerned.
Dianese
Have the Verbier Pelle Gore-Tex jacket at £620 and the Verbier Pelle Gore-Tex trousers at £400. Sure to look nice…
Rukka – Merlin
You know Rukka stuff is going to be good but at £1,400 for the jacket and £1,200 for the trousers, making an eye watering total of £2,600 that becomes very hard to justify.
